MySQL是一種流行的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它能夠?yàn)槠髽I(yè)提供高效、可靠的數(shù)據(jù)存儲(chǔ)方案。許多人都知道MySQL被廣泛應(yīng)用于數(shù)據(jù)存儲(chǔ)和管理方面,但是否可以將其用作數(shù)據(jù)倉(cāng)庫(kù)呢?讓我們來(lái)看看。
首先,我們需要了解數(shù)據(jù)倉(cāng)庫(kù)的概念。數(shù)據(jù)倉(cāng)庫(kù)是一個(gè)存儲(chǔ)大量數(shù)據(jù)的集合,用于支持企業(yè)的決策制定和業(yè)務(wù)分析。與傳統(tǒng)數(shù)據(jù)庫(kù)不同,數(shù)據(jù)倉(cāng)庫(kù)通常包含來(lái)自不同數(shù)據(jù)源的大量數(shù)據(jù),這些數(shù)據(jù)被組織成主題和維度,以便支持業(yè)務(wù)分析和決策制定。
MySQL可以用作數(shù)據(jù)倉(cāng)庫(kù)的解決方案,因?yàn)樗哂幸韵乱恍﹥?yōu)點(diǎn):
1. 強(qiáng)大的存儲(chǔ)和管理能力:MySQL可以處理大量的數(shù)據(jù),而提供高效的存儲(chǔ)和管理功能。其靈活的架構(gòu)適用于不同類(lèi)型的數(shù)據(jù)倉(cāng)庫(kù)數(shù)據(jù)集;
2. 易于集成和使用:MySQL輕松處理多種數(shù)據(jù)類(lèi)型,使其易于與其他數(shù)據(jù)源和數(shù)據(jù)管理工具進(jìn)行集成;
3. 可用性和可靠性:MySQL是一種成熟的開(kāi)源數(shù)據(jù)庫(kù)管理系統(tǒng),在高負(fù)荷情況下也能夠保持可用性和可靠性。
但是,MySQL也有一些局限性,這些局限性可能會(huì)影響其作為數(shù)據(jù)倉(cāng)庫(kù)的使用。這些局限性包括以下方面:
1. 缺乏標(biāo)準(zhǔn)數(shù)據(jù)倉(cāng)庫(kù)應(yīng)用程序:盡管MySQL可以處理數(shù)據(jù)倉(cāng)庫(kù)數(shù)據(jù),但它缺乏像其他專門(mén)為數(shù)據(jù)倉(cāng)庫(kù)開(kāi)發(fā)的應(yīng)用程序那樣的標(biāo)準(zhǔn)工具;
2. 缺乏成熟的BI和ETL支持:MySQL并不像其他商用數(shù)據(jù)倉(cāng)庫(kù)技術(shù)那樣提供完整的BI和ETL(數(shù)據(jù)提取,轉(zhuǎn)換和加載)解決方案;
3. 難以擴(kuò)展:MySQL缺乏像其他大型商用數(shù)據(jù)倉(cāng)庫(kù)技術(shù)那樣的無(wú)限擴(kuò)展性,尤其是在擴(kuò)展數(shù)據(jù)和負(fù)載時(shí)。
因此,盡管MySQL可以作為數(shù)據(jù)倉(cāng)庫(kù)的解決方案,但在決定是否使用MySQL作為數(shù)據(jù)倉(cāng)庫(kù)時(shí),務(wù)必考慮其優(yōu)點(diǎn)和局限性。